I love the squeezer that I've remixed. The downside is that it requires a lot of time (& lot of filament) to be printed. In addition, it is a little bit complicated because of the ratcheting parts. I wanted to design an extremely simple one (with only 2 parts), with an anti-unrolling system but without ratchet (because of the wearing out of the teeth). PRINTING & ASSEMBLY The frame is a simple U frame, but to make it more solid I designed it flat, so that the loops, the rod (winding key) is going through, are as solid as possible. It requires some extra work after printing, bending the ends to 90° (using boiling water) but it's easy to do. Nb1: heat each end, dunking it up to the level of the V grove (all of the groove has to be in the water), and angle them to 90° using your working table surface (wait until they remain upright). If you don't want to boil & bend the flat frame, print the U version (side onto the printer's bed as shown in my CURA's screen captures) . Loops are going to be weaker, however, because of this orientation. Nb2: after you have put the key all the way through the frame, dunk the tip of the key into boiling water to soft it. Then expand the grove of the tip a little bit, so the key won't come off when pulled because the lips of the tip will limit the travel. HOW IT WORKS Pull the head of the key sliding it to stop position (it's a 6mm travel), so the hexagonal part of the rod gets out of the hexagonal hole of the frame, Roll the tube (don't pressurize it too much!), Push the key back in locking position. THE PACK INCLUDES THE FUSION 360 ARCHIVE (.f3d), so you can create customised keys; everyone of the family can have the desired style of key. Printing keys: if you are used to spools swapping, you can reveal the pattern of the logos that are embossed. I hope you can spend a minute to share your makes, specially if you print this squeezer in nice colours & with customized keys. PRINTING Concentric 100% with 4mm brim. PLA does the job.
